The Benefits of Using an Exercise Bicycle
Before diving into the specifics, it's essential to comprehend why exercise bikes are so popular and useful for physical fitness lovers:
Low Impact on Joints: Unlike running or high-impact aerobics, biking is a low-impact activity that puts very little tension on your knees, ankles, and hips. This makes it a perfect option for people with joint pain or those recuperating from injuries.
Cardiovascular Health: Regular biking can considerably improve heart health by increasing cardiovascular endurance and decreasing the threat of heart problem.
Weight Loss and Muscle Toning: Cycling is a terrific way to burn calories and tone your legs, glutes, and core muscles. It can be a crucial element of any weight loss program.
Flexibility: Exercise bikes offer a range of resistance levels and exercise programs, making them suitable for all fitness levels and objectives.
Benefit: With a stationary bicycle, you can work out in the house, despite the weather condition or time of day.
Mental Health: Cycling can decrease tension and stress and anxiety, offering a meditative and pleasurable workout experience.
Kinds Of Exercise Bicycles
There are several types of exercise bikes, each created to accommodate different fitness needs and preferences:
Upright Exercise Bicycles
Description: These bikes imitate the standard cycling experience, with a more upright riding position.
Advantages: They are exceptional for weight loss and improving cardiovascular health. They also use a large range of resistance levels.
Best For: Beginners, individuals with lower back concerns, and those who choose a more upright posture.
Recumbent Exercise Bicycles
Description: Recumbent bikes have a reclined seating position with a back-rest, offering more support and comfort.
Benefits: They are especially beneficial for people with back or knee problems, as they distribute weight more uniformly and decrease strain.
Best For: Users with pain in the back, older adults, and those who need a more encouraging exercise environment.
Spin Bicycles
Description: Spin bikes are designed for high-intensity period training (HIIT) and emulate the experience of outside biking.
Benefits: They use a more tough exercise and are fantastic for developing leg strength and endurance. Spin bikes also frequently featured functions like adjustable handlebars and seat positions.
Best For: Advanced cyclists, people searching for a more intense workout, and those who delight in group biking classes.
Smart Exercise Bicycles
Description: Smart bikes are linked to the web and come with interactive functions, such as virtual classes and real-time efficiency tracking.
Advantages: They provide a more interesting and motivating exercise experience, with the capability to track progress and sign up with neighborhood workouts.
Best For: Tech-savvy users, those who enjoy online classes, and individuals who desire to track their fitness metrics.
How to Choose the Best Exercise Bicycle
Picking the ideal exercise bicycle includes thinking about numerous elements to ensure it meets your physical fitness goals and convenience needs:
Physical fitness Goals
Weight Reduction: Look for a bike with a broad range of resistance levels and a calorie burn tracker.
Cardiovascular Health: Choose a bike that uses a smooth and constant pedaling experience.
Rehabilitation: Opt for a recumbent bike with a comfortable seat and helpful backrest.
Spending plan
Entry-Level: Upright bikes are typically more cost effective and suitable for beginners.
Mid-Range: Recumbent bikes and entry-level spin bikes offer more functions and are suitable for intermediate users.
High-End: Smart bikes and premium spin bikes include advanced features, such as virtual classes and premium build materials.
Space Constraints
Small Spaces: Consider compact upright bikes or foldable models.
Larger Spaces: Spin bikes and smart bikes can be bigger but offer more features and a much better exercise experience.
Convenience
Seat: Ensure the seat is adjustable and comfy. Some bikes feature gel or memory foam seats for included comfort.
Handlebars: Look for bikes with adjustable handlebars to accommodate different riding positions.
Construct Quality and Durability
Frame: A sturdy, sturdy frame is essential for stability and durability.
Resistance System: Magnetic resistance is typically quieter and smoother than friction-based systems.
Additional Features
Heart Rate Monitor: Useful for monitoring cardiovascular health.
LCD Display: Provides real-time feedback on speed, distance, and calories burned.
Connection: Smart bikes can connect to apps and online platforms for a more interactive experience.

FAQs
Q: What is the very best exercise bicycle for weight-loss?
A: For weight reduction, an upright exercise bicycle like the Schwinn 170 VR is a great option. It uses a vast array of resistance levels and a range of workout programs to keep you engaged and challenged.
Q: Are recumbent bikes good for back pain?
A: Yes, recumbent bikes are particularly advantageous for people with back pain. Their reclined style supplies support and reduces stress on the spinal column. The ProForm 750R Recumbent Bike is a good alternative with a comfy seat and adjustable backrest.
Q: How frequently should I use an exercise bicycle?
A: Aim for a minimum of 30 minutes of cycling, 3-5 times a week, to see considerable fitness benefits. Consistency is key, and gradually increasing the period and strength of your workouts can help you accomplish your objectives much faster.
Q: What are the upkeep requirements for an exercise bicycle?
A: Regular upkeep consists of keeping the bike clean, oiling the chain (for spin bikes), and ensuring all bolts and screws are tightened up. Check the maker's standards for specific upkeep requirements.
Q: Can I utilize an exercise bicycle for rehabilitation?
A: Yes, exercise bikes can be used for rehabilitation. Recumbent bikes are especially ideal for this function as they supply a low-impact and helpful exercise. Always talk to a healthcare professional before beginning any brand-new exercise routine, especially if you are recuperating from an injury.
